Acta Cryst. (2009). E65, m84-m85 [ doi:10.1107/S1600536808041895 ]
Abstract: The zinc(II) complex with NOTA [2,2',2''-(1,4,7-triazanonane-1,4,7-triyl)triacetate] has previously been synthesized and studied in solution, but was not isolated. The corresponding title ZnII complex pentasodium(I) bis{[2,2',2''-(1,4,7-triazanonane-1,4,7-triyl)triacetato]zinc(II)} tris(perchlorate) methanol solvate, Na5[Zn(C12H18N3O6)]2(ClO4)3·CH3OH, was crystallized as a sodium perchlorate double salt in methanol solution. The asymmetric unit contains two independent [Zn(NOTA)]- complex anion entities, five sodium cations, three perchlorate anions and a methanol solvent molecule. The two ZnII cations exhibit a distorted trigonal-prismatic N3O3 coordination with a bifacial arrangement of the donor atoms. Neither the methanol solvent molecule nor the perchlorate anions appear to be coordinated to the Zn centres. The crystal structure shows a layer arrangement parallel to (001) generated by interactions between the [Zn(NOTA)]- units, the Na+ cations, two ClO4- units and the methanole molecule, leading to an overall layer composition of [Na5[Zn(C12H18N3O6)]2(ClO4)2.CH3OH]+. The third ClO4 anion is isolated and situated between the layers without any significant interactions.
